Prison Officer Earn up to $85,967 with a base salary of $59,825 plus penalty rates and overtime Annual salary increases, 5 weeks annual leave, 3 weeks personal leave and provisions for study leave 41 days paid full-time training Complete a Certificate III in Correctional Practice (Adult Custodial) Join a supportive team and a culture focussed on career progression New $5,000 sign-on bonus New prison officers are now eligible for a bonus of up to $5,000. Six months after commencing, you will receive a payment of $2,500. Then, after one year’s full-time employment, you will receive an additional payment of $2,500. This incentive is designed to attract the best new prison officers and encourage you to explore all aspects of the role. About the role Becoming a prison officer Department of Justice and Community Safety Victoria offers you a secure career with a competitive salary and a focus on a healthy work-life balance. Your work will be dynamic and every day will be different. You will: Be a positive influence on prisoners Support prisoner rehabilitation through case management Protect the safety and security of staff and prisoners Whatever work background you’re from – retail, hospitality, administration, construction, education, healthcare, manufacturing or community services (to name a few) - your experience has already set you up to succeed in this role. If you're keen on a move to metro or country Victoria and are offered an ongoing role, you may be eligible for reimbursement of up to $10,000 to help with costs like travel, freight, temporary housing and storage.
